Handover note — customer dedup pipeline

Welcome aboard. I'm passing MergeMint, our dedup pipeline at Larkspur Retail, over to you. Nightly runs match records by fuzzy name and postal fields, then queue merges for review. The match-threshold config lives in the ops vault; never lower it below 0.85 without sign-off. To open the vault, use the recovery passphrase below.

unlock words, hafop-tahog: drumir-druiel-kasox-wenax-tamys-frair

## 2.9.1 — Key rotation

Rotated the artifact signing key after the clock-skew incident between build agents bx-04 and bx-07. Skew of ~40s caused timestamp validation failures on signed manifests, which looked like tampering alerts but were benign. NTP sync is now enforced at agent startup and drift above 2s fails the build. Old key is revoked as of this release; alerts referencing it can be closed. The replacement signing key is as follows.

deploy key for kaduf-bagep: bky6_NNeq4d

Ticket: Turnstile count sync failing at Bramfield Arena. For new team members: the GateTally counter units push entry totals to the central attendance store every minute. Since the Saturday match, units on the east concourse report connection timeouts and fall back to local buffering. Buffered counts flush once connectivity returns, so totals are eventually correct, but live dashboards lag. First step is verifying the store accepts writes from your workstation. Connect to the attendance database with the connection string below.

database URL for tajog-bajeg: mysql://soreth_svc:OzsCjhu@db-6997.nelvrostack.internal:5432/kelax